What is there to see in Burnt Islands?

Places to visit in the wider area include Rose Blanche Lighthouse, Grand Bay West Beach, and Scott's Cove Park. You'll also find Railway Heritage Centre and The Hook and Line Interpretation Centre in the area. Check out what more to see and do in Expedia's Burnt Islands guide.

What's the weather like in Burnt Islands?

The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 58°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 26°F. Average annual precipitation for Burnt Islands is 61 inches.
